BIG BROTHERS BIG SISTERS OF OZAUKEE COUNTY INC, founded in 1974, is a small nonprofit that reported $216K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ue decreased 8% compared to the prior year.

Mission

Creating and supporting one-to-one mentoring relationships that ignite the power and promise of youth.
